WEST HAVEN, Conn. – The University of New Haven volleyball team opened up its home schedule at Charger Gymnasium with a 3-1 (21-25, 25-19, 25-16, 25-19) win over non-conference opponent Post University on Thursday night.
Junior
Kristine Rios (Miami, Fla./Coral Reef) completed her first triple double of the season and ninth of her career with 10 kills, 41 assists, and team-high 14 digs, while tying her career-high in service aces with four. Rios also finished with a .588 hitting percentage and did not suffer an attacking error on the night.
Joining Rios in leading the Chargers hitting efforts was senior
Caroline Martins (Tres Pontas, Brazil) and freshman
Kali Greathead (Temecula, Calif./Temecula Valley). Martins finished her third match of the season in double figures with 13 kills, while Greathead also matched that amount and also added 12 digs on the evening.
Among the hitting leaders was also
Mallory Nowicki (Grand Rapids, Mich./Northview) who finished with a season-high 10 kills and only two errors in 17 total attempts for a .471 hitting average.
Junior libero
Lindsey Kim (Rye Brook, N.Y./Blind Brook) had 13 digs for the Chargers, one of three Chargers in double figures in the defensive category.
As a team, the Chargers combined for five total blocks, led by senior
Alex Bussey (Atlanta, Ga./Pace Academy) who had two blocks and nine kills, good for a .400 hitting percentage. Rios, Nowicky, and senior Fernanda Da Silva also had one block each.
